Why is it an issue that they no longer accept paypal? They are still reputable.
 
because dh gate sells copied goods, paypal has been threatened endlessly with lawsuits by large conglomerates who have the power to cripple their business. the only way around it is to buy direct from traders online who fall under the radar of paypal. they are out there, but it takes a little more work than just using the search function on sites like dh gate and alibaba.

anyone who wants to work with alibaba please check the seller before you buy, if its too good to be true its because it is...
Even if the company is alibaba gold something and have 2 years or more do not send money to China using westerunion because you have a great chance to lose your money.
I do business on alibaba but I only deal if the seller accepts escrow.
